When you party hard, what is your heaviest level?
Nott Wisarut: How hard is it? You’ve been complimenting me lately. Really? The hardest time was when I was in my early 20s after graduating from university. All my close friends were foreigners. After graduating, we all liked to come and live in Thailand. We promised each other that we would stay in Thailand for 2 months, about 60 days. We made a pact that for 60 days and 60 nights, we had to party every night. We had to make it happen. Even today, my friends who work in Hong Kong still talk about this.

When you were broke, how much did you weigh?
Nott Wisarut: During that time I didn’t weigh much, but I was probably around 80 kilos. I had no muscle at all. I used to be in university for 4 years, go to the weights every week, play football on the weekends. When I came back to Thailand I had nothing. I let myself go, ate everything, still ate late at night, still ate at 1-2 AM. At that time I didn’t feel anything because I went out until 6 AM. At 9 AM on Saturday I was still playing football. I didn’t sleep much, didn’t eat well, didn’t do weight training, lost muscle. I don’t know how it came back. Maybe it’s because I have a wife, kids, family, so I came back to take care of myself.

What is the point where you feel you need to take care of your health?
Nott Wisarut: It was when my dad got sick. When I had free time, I started looking for information. Some people said that cancer is hereditary, but we studied about food and lifestyle to prevent it, what could help cure it. At that time, there wasn’t much information. It took time. What I knew was that I had to come back and adjust my lifestyle.

What did you change at that time?
Nott Wisarut: If you know, can you do it? Knowing and doing are two different things. Some people say that they know that eating a lot makes them fat, but can they stop their mouths? They know that sugar is bad, can they stop it? It will take some time, maybe a week, to find knowledge. They need discipline and consistency before they can change until it becomes a habit. It takes 10 years to become a lifestyle.

Has the food changed a lot?
Nott Wisarut: Food has changed a lot. People need to eat enough protein. I don’t believe that we need to eat all 5 food groups because the body really doesn’t need sugar and starch as much as it should. Personally, I believe that sugar and starch are the causes of high cholesterol, not fat. I’ve experimented on myself. This is my personal belief. Therefore, breakfast is not necessary. These days, I wake up early and don’t eat anything. I drink coffee and go lift weights. It’s been 5 years and I haven’t eaten breakfast.

What is your regular menu?
Nott Wisarut: Eat vegetables first: broccoli, asparagus, zucchini, tomatoes. After that, I’ll eat protein: chicken, beef, salmon, 6 eggs a day. Eat good oils like extra virgin olive oil, ghee, and coconut oil. Don’t use vegetable oil. Don’t put in a lot of seasonings. Breakfast, lunch, and dinner, 3 meals. If there aren’t business people to talk about, I’ll eat at home every day.

About sleeping?
Nott Wisarut: I try to go to bed at the same time. At home, by 8 pm, everyone is already in bed. I have to sit and work a little bit. By 11 pm, I try to sleep 8-9 hours. I measure REM and Deep sleep to get at least 2 hours. If I can’t, I have to find the cause, such as eating too much or being too stressed.
